diff options
author | falkTX <falktx@gmail.com> | 2015-06-13 17:46:09 +0200 |
---|---|---|
committer | falkTX <falktx@gmail.com> | 2015-06-13 17:46:09 +0200 |
commit | 9038ee0032e29a69993de1f9baaac11ace73207d (patch) | |
tree | 78b96c034bc80f0bc99e24ee8a059a83c9ecc416 | |
parent | 12bb7420f9e2145e7dc16fd5e212cb5c274a5f79 (diff) |
Disable programs on AutoSat
-rw-r--r-- | .gitignore | 1 | ||||
-rw-r--r-- | plugins/ZamAutoSat/DistrhoPluginInfo.h | 2 | ||||
-rw-r--r-- | plugins/ZamAutoSat/ZamAutoSatPlugin.cpp | 21 | ||||
-rw-r--r-- | plugins/ZamAutoSat/ZamAutoSatPlugin.hpp | 2 | ||||
-rw-r--r-- | plugins/ZamAutoSat/ZamAutoSatUI.cpp | 4 | ||||
-rw-r--r-- | plugins/ZamAutoSat/ZamAutoSatUI.hpp | 1 |
6 files changed, 3 insertions, 28 deletions
@@ -1,4 +1,5 @@ *.a +*.d *.o *.exe diff --git a/plugins/ZamAutoSat/DistrhoPluginInfo.h b/plugins/ZamAutoSat/DistrhoPluginInfo.h index 9ee8f5e..aa2a80d 100644 --- a/plugins/ZamAutoSat/DistrhoPluginInfo.h +++ b/plugins/ZamAutoSat/DistrhoPluginInfo.h @@ -27,7 +27,7 @@ #define DISTRHO_PLUGIN_NUM_OUTPUTS 1 #define DISTRHO_PLUGIN_WANT_LATENCY 0 -#define DISTRHO_PLUGIN_WANT_PROGRAMS 1 +#define DISTRHO_PLUGIN_WANT_PROGRAMS 0 #define DISTRHO_PLUGIN_WANT_STATE 0 #define DISTRHO_PLUGIN_WANT_TIMEPOS 0 #define DISTRHO_PLUGIN_IS_RT_SAFE 1 diff --git a/plugins/ZamAutoSat/ZamAutoSatPlugin.cpp b/plugins/ZamAutoSat/ZamAutoSatPlugin.cpp index 1026cfe..cb90056 100644 --- a/plugins/ZamAutoSat/ZamAutoSatPlugin.cpp +++ b/plugins/ZamAutoSat/ZamAutoSatPlugin.cpp @@ -22,11 +22,8 @@ START_NAMESPACE_DISTRHO // ----------------------------------------------------------------------- ZamAutoSatPlugin::ZamAutoSatPlugin() - : Plugin(paramCount, 1, 0) // 1 program, 0 states + : Plugin(paramCount, 0, 0) // 0 programs, 0 states { - // set default values - loadProgram(0); - // reset deactivate(); } @@ -42,14 +39,6 @@ void ZamAutoSatPlugin::initParameter(uint32_t, Parameter&) { } -void ZamAutoSatPlugin::initProgramName(uint32_t index, String& programName) -{ - if (index != 0) - return; - - programName = "Default"; -} - // ----------------------------------------------------------------------- // Internal data @@ -62,14 +51,6 @@ void ZamAutoSatPlugin::setParameterValue(uint32_t, float) { } -void ZamAutoSatPlugin::loadProgram(uint32_t index) -{ - if (index != 0) - return; - - activate(); -} - // ----------------------------------------------------------------------- // Process diff --git a/plugins/ZamAutoSat/ZamAutoSatPlugin.hpp b/plugins/ZamAutoSat/ZamAutoSatPlugin.hpp index 5f4c1d4..194527e 100644 --- a/plugins/ZamAutoSat/ZamAutoSatPlugin.hpp +++ b/plugins/ZamAutoSat/ZamAutoSatPlugin.hpp @@ -68,14 +68,12 @@ protected: // Init
void initParameter(uint32_t index, Parameter& parameter) override;
- void initProgramName(uint32_t index, String& programName) override;
// -------------------------------------------------------------------
// Internal data
float getParameterValue(uint32_t index) const override;
void setParameterValue(uint32_t index, float value) override;
- void loadProgram(uint32_t index) override;
// -------------------------------------------------------------------
void activate() override;
diff --git a/plugins/ZamAutoSat/ZamAutoSatUI.cpp b/plugins/ZamAutoSat/ZamAutoSatUI.cpp index e6fac33..a087d7d 100644 --- a/plugins/ZamAutoSat/ZamAutoSatUI.cpp +++ b/plugins/ZamAutoSat/ZamAutoSatUI.cpp @@ -42,10 +42,6 @@ void ZamAutoSatUI::parameterChanged(uint32_t, float) { } -void ZamAutoSatUI::programLoaded(uint32_t) -{ -} - // ----------------------------------------------------------------------- void ZamAutoSatUI::onDisplay() diff --git a/plugins/ZamAutoSat/ZamAutoSatUI.hpp b/plugins/ZamAutoSat/ZamAutoSatUI.hpp index 5ca0c29..c19b984 100644 --- a/plugins/ZamAutoSat/ZamAutoSatUI.hpp +++ b/plugins/ZamAutoSat/ZamAutoSatUI.hpp @@ -42,7 +42,6 @@ protected: // DSP Callbacks void parameterChanged(uint32_t index, float value) override; - void programLoaded(uint32_t index) override; // ------------------------------------------------------------------- |